I have a new nephew

I can't remember if I mentioned this before or not - when we got the last update from our agency on little frijolito it was a report written by the agency's worker in Guatemala. She visits all the baby's monthly and takes pictures, writes a report, etc. On the first report we got it stated that little frijolito was being fostered with her cousin. We even got a picture of them together. I thought it was pretty amazing that she was actually with her cousin!

I posted on the Guatemala thread of the adoption forums to find out if anyone was adopting a little boy by his name. No response. I was planning to ask the agency if I could get information on the parents adopting the little boy but I was waiting until we were a bit further along.

Today I was reading the "big list" which is a list serv for Guatemala adoption. There were several replies going back and forth about the agency we are using. I was reading along and saw a post from a lady that said she is currently using this agency and having no problems at all, and that their foster mom was the same age as our foster mom, and was also a retired nurse. I thought to myself a little too coincidental.......this must be who is adopting the cousin!

So I emailed her and sure enough - it is! I have found who is adopting frijolito's little male cousin! She was thrilled to find us too, she had told the agency that she would like contact with the adoptive family of the little girl but they hadn't told me that yet. We have a lot of things in common too - very ironic things.

They also received an update Friday (NO WE DIDN'T GET ONE YET.........ARGH) and she emailed me 2 pictures of their little L and our little M was in the background looking as cute as she could be.

They are a little ahead of us since we had the whole  POA fiasco. I hope we can catch up though so maybe we can do our pick up trip together. They live pretty far from us so there won't be daily lunches or anything but at least we will have contact with them......and just maybe (hopefully) our little girl and their little boy will be able to know their very own biological cousin. Isn't that cool?

Oracle of Adoption


  • 10/31/07: Citizenship Ceremony at USCIS. Finally Marissa is a US Citizen!

  • 10/17/06: Mailed N-600 (application for US Citizenship) to USCIS

  • 10/16/06: Post Placement visit completed

  • 5/16/06: Court date for re-adoption

  • 4/17/06: Began re-adoption process

  • 3/16/06: Our little Mayan Princess finally arrives in the US!!

  • 3/13/06: Marissa placed in our arms - united as a family forever. Six months to the day after the referral.

  • 3/2/06: Pink! We have pink! Embassy appointment is for 3/14/06. We leave for Guatemala on 3/12/06.

  • 2/24/06: GCBC issued! Must be a record! We didn't find out though until 2/28...but that's ok because at that time we also learned that we had a passport and had been submitted for pink! Talk about a FAT TUESDAY!

  • 2/16/06: Protocolo signed. GCBC requested on 2/17.

  • 2/14/06: Out of PGN! Happy Valentines Day to us!

  • 12/21/05: Entered PGN

  • 12/12/05: Pre-Approval Issued! Also found out we went into Family Court on 10/28/05 and got out on 11/22/05.

  • 11/28/05: Received 3rd report from case worker with medical report and new pictures. Frijolito has herself a little personality!

  • 10/25/05: Received 2nd update from Guatemalan case worker with medical report and updated pictures

  • 10/19/05: DNA is a match! Certified and sent to the US Embassy. DNA was done on birthmom and baby on 10/7/05 but we never knew it.

  • 10/10/05 - POA delivered to agency. Delay was due to Hurricane Rita in Houston and then wrong date stamp by Consulate.

  • 09/19/05 - Dossier DONE and delivered to agency. We also received our 1st Report from the Guatemalan Case Worker with medical information and pictures of the baby! Baby's nickname is "frijolito".

  • 09/13/05 - Referral of baby girl born on 8/20/05!!!

  • 08/12/05 - Received I-171H approval fro USCIS!

  • 07/23/05 - Fingerprinted at USCIS office

  • 07/14/05 - Home Study mailed to USCIS

  • 06/24/05 - Home Study done

  • 04/08/05 - Mailed I-600A to USCIS
